Kafka & Spark Streaming Services in Dubai

Stralya designs, builds, and operates Kafka & Spark Streaming architectures that turn your data into real-time decisions. From event-driven web platforms to mission-critical dashboards, we take full ownership of your streaming pipeline – from design to production and long-term reliability.

Service scope

What Our Kafka & Spark Streaming Service Includes

Stralya’s Kafka & Spark Streaming service is designed for organisations that treat data as a strategic asset. Whether you are launching a new real-time platform or upgrading an existing system, we provide a complete, end-to-end service that connects your web applications, databases, and analytics in a single, coherent streaming architecture.

Core components we design and deliver

Kafka cluster design, sizing, and configuration (self-managed or cloud-managed).
Topic, partition, and retention strategies aligned with your data and compliance needs.
Producers and consumers integrated with your web applications, APIs, and microservices.
Spark Streaming or Structured Streaming jobs for aggregation, enrichment, and analytics.
Schema registry setup and governance for safe data evolution over time.
Connectors to databases, data warehouses, data lakes, and third-party systems.
Monitoring, logging, and alerting dashboards for full observability of the streaming layer.
Disaster recovery, backup, and failover strategies tailored to your risk appetite.
Security hardening: authentication, authorisation, encryption, and network isolation.
Documentation, runbooks, and knowledge transfer to your internal teams.

Optional add-ons and accelerators

Real-time analytics dashboards for business and operations teams.
Event-driven microservices design for new or existing web platforms.
Migration from legacy batch ETL to streaming-first architectures.
Migration from legacy batch ETL to streaming-first architectures.
On-call support and SLA-based maintenance for production streaming systems.
Architecture reviews and coaching for in-house engineering and data teams.
Each engagement is scoped to your context: your cloud provider, your traffic profile, your compliance constraints, and your internal capabilities. Our fixed-price model gives you clarity on effort and outcomes, while our long-term partnership mindset ensures your streaming platform keeps pace with your ambitions in Dubai and beyond.

Designed for Ambitious Digital Teams in Dubai

Aligned with your strategic objectives
We start from your business goals – faster decision-making, better user experience, or operational automation – and design Kafka & Spark Streaming solutions that directly support those outcomes.
Built for demanding web experiences
Whether you run one of the best real estate websites in the region or a high-traffic corporate portal, we ensure your streaming layer can sustain growth without sacrificing performance or stability.
Suitable for startups, enterprises, and government
From venture-backed startups to large enterprises and semi-government entities, we adapt our processes, documentation, and governance to your environment while maintaining our engineering standards.
A long-term, accountable partner
We do not disappear after delivery. Stralya is built on reliability, commitment, and trust – staying beside you as your streaming needs evolve and your digital footprint expands across the GCC.

How we work

A Structured, Fixed-Price Approach to Streaming Projects

Every Kafka & Spark Streaming engagement at Stralya is run like a strategic product, not a technical experiment. We work on a fixed-price, clearly scoped basis whenever possible, so your team knows exactly what will be delivered, when, and under which conditions. For highly specialised needs, we can complement your internal team with senior-only experts.

We start by understanding your business flows, data sources, and latency requirements. Together with your CTO, product, or data teams, we map the events, topics, and consumers that matter: from user activity on your website to back-office operations and external integrations.
We design a target architecture using Kafka, Spark Streaming (or Structured Streaming), and complementary services such as schema registries, connectors, and data sinks. We align this with your chosen cloud provider (AWS, Azure, GCP) and your security and compliance constraints.
Our engineers implement producers, consumers, streaming jobs, and data models with a strong focus on idempotency, back-pressure management, and fault tolerance. We load-test the pipeline, tune configuration, and validate behaviour under realistic Dubai-scale traffic conditions.
We containerise and deploy your streaming components using modern DevOps practices. We implement dashboards, alerts, and runbooks so your teams know exactly how to operate, observe, and troubleshoot the system in production.
Once in production, we can stay as your long-term partner, improving throughput, reducing costs, adding new data products, and supporting new business lines – without compromising on stability or security.

Popular Questions

Find Commonly Asked Questions

Kafka & Spark Streaming are ideal for platforms where real-time or near real-time data is critical: high-traffic web marketplaces, real estate portals, logistics and delivery platforms, fintech and trading dashboards, IoT and smart-city systems, and any organisation that needs instant analytics or event-driven automation. If your users or internal teams are waiting for data to refresh, you are likely a strong candidate for streaming.
You do not always need both. Kafka is typically used as the backbone for event streaming and decoupling services, while Spark Streaming is used for complex processing, aggregations, and analytics on top of those streams. In some cases, Kafka plus lightweight stream processors are enough; in others, Spark is essential. During discovery, we recommend the minimal, future-proof stack that fits your use cases and team capacity.
Yes. One of Stralya’s strengths is “project rescue”. We audit your current Kafka clusters, topics, consumer groups, and Spark jobs; identify bottlenecks, misconfigurations, and risks; then stabilise and refactor the architecture. Our goal is to restore confidence in your streaming layer while keeping business disruption to a minimum.
We apply strict engineering standards: replication and partitioning strategies, secure authentication and authorisation, schema management, idempotent producers, consumer lag monitoring, back-pressure handling, and detailed logging and tracing. On the security side, we align with your cloud provider’s best practices, enforce least privilege, and integrate with your existing IAM, VPC, and encryption policies.
Whenever the scope is clear and stable, yes. We prefer fixed-price, outcome-focused engagements where deliverables, timelines, and quality expectations are agreed upfront. For highly exploratory or ongoing internal platform work, we can provide selective senior staff augmentation to strengthen your existing team.

Case Studies

Real solutions Real impact.

These aren’t just polished visuals they’re real projects solving real problems. Each case study 
apply strategy, design, and development.

View Work

Building a Monolithic Headless CMS with Next.js

A monolithic headless CMS, engineered with React and Next.js App Router to ship high-performance websites and product frontends fast, with clean content operations for non-technical teams.

6

weeks from first commit to production-ready CMS core.

3x

faster time-to-market for new marketing and product pages.

View Project Details

View Work

Mandarin Platform Project Takeover and Recovery

Taking over a third-party Mandarin e-learning platform to secure, stabilise and structure critical cloud-native components for long-term growth.

6

weeks to stabilise and secure the core platform after takeover.

0

critical incidents in production after Stralya’s recovery phase.

View Project Details

Client Testimonials

Projects delivered for ambitious teams

Get an expert commitment on your delivery